Image Title:
Petition to the centurion
Trismegistos Number:
Citation reference:
P. Ryl. 2 141
Description:
A petition to a centurion, complaining of an assault and robbery following a dispute over compensation owed for illicit grazing
Creation site:
Egypt: Euhemeria (mod. Qasr el-Banat)
Date created:
April-May 37 CE
Time period covered:
1 BCE - 500 CE
Place covered:
Egypt: Euhemeria (mod. Qasr el-Banat)
People covered:
Gaius Trebius Iustus (centurion)
People covered:
Petermouthis, son of Herakleios (farmer, tax-collector)
People covered:
Antonia Drusi (landowner)
People covered:
Papontos, son of Orsenouphis (shepherd)
People covered:
Apion/Kapareis (shepherd)
Language:
Greek
